Searching for fire retardant fabric

roni | Posted in Fabric and Trim on

I’m looking for fire retardant fabric that is nascar approved for drivers

suits. They are called either proban or nomex fabrics. I would appreciate any

 information on sources for these.

  1. sueb | | #1

    check the dupont web site for where you can buy nomex as they are the manufacturers of the product.
